The Hidalgo County Immunization Program provides
vaccines throughout the year to children and adults through federal
& state funded programs and medical coverage/insurances. This
Program also dedicates their efforts to raise awareness and educate
Hidalgo County residents and medical providers on vaccine-preventable
diseases and updates on medical countermeasures. The funded programs
include Texas Vaccines for Children (TVFC) and Adult Safety Net (ASN).
To receive free vaccines through TVFC or ASN, a patient must meet
eligibility requirements. Medical coverage and insurances that are
accepted by the Health Department include CHIP, Medicaid, Blue Cross
& Blue Shield of Texas, United Health, Superior, Driscoll, and
Molina. If you would like to verify insurance coverage prior to

Immunizations are offered at
the Hidalgo County Health Clinics and are entered into the ImmTrac-Texas
Immunization Registry (ImmTrac). ImmTrac allows for medical providers,
parents, and patients to view, print, and save their updated
immunization record in an electronically safe way.
